Output 40bc621bad7072720c46d85bc5182c4b27fc63bb10034eee5bb114529a8f2b99:79

value
120361862
script pubkey
OP_0 OP_PUSHBYTES_32 a2aa9a3f7643cfd065fb7f735969d98db4023dd9f7f1c7532cf9aae3d402fa18
address
bc1q524f50mkg08aqe0m0ae4j6we3k6qy0we7lcuw5evlx4w84qzlgvqkyay77
transaction
40bc621bad7072720c46d85bc5182c4b27fc63bb10034eee5bb114529a8f2b99
spent
true